CSP 067: Transgender Discrimination in CSD Programs
You may remember Dr. Charles Lenell (pronouns: they/them) from episode 49 (The Doctoral Shortage). Dr. Lenell is back to discuss an online petition they filed with change.org. The gist of the petition: LGBTQ students at some colleges and universities face discrimination due to a loophole afforded by 'religious exemption.' The petition asks for transparency so potential students can better decide which programs will meet their needs. Essential to this conversation is an understanding of the role of the Council on Academic Accreditation (CAA) as well as what protections Title IX provides in theory and practice.

CSP 063: Jill Escher (National Council on Severe Autism)
Jill Escher is president of the National Council on Severe Autism (NCSA), an organization formed over two years ago by a group of parents looking to raise awareness and advocate for autistic individuals with more severe manifestations of autism. The NCSA has been sounding the alarm bells regarding the lack of societal preparedness for the magnitude of young adults leaving the educational system at 21. They address complex issues without pulling punches—housing, therapy interventions, mental health, guardianship, and the neurodiversity movement are all covered through a combination of position statements, webinars, and powerful blog pieces. CSP 053: Chandler Speaks
Chandler Speaks is a nonprofit charitable organization recently launched in the Dallas-Ft. Worth area. Its goal is to raise money to help needy families with the cost of ongoing speech therapy. The organization was started by Bryce Moen, a business executive in Texas who was looking for an opportunity to give back to the community. He found a need when his own daughter Chandler was diagnosed with a speech disorder. For more information about the organization, go to www.chandlerspeaks.org. Thanks for listening!
